Engine Components and Common Issues
Familiarity with your vehicle's mechanical elements is essential for maintaining ideal performance and preventing costly repairs. Let's focus on key engine parts and typical problems.

The engine block functions as the core component that houses the cylinders where combustion occurs. Pistons within these cylinders change fuel energy to mechanical energy. The crankshaft then changes this vertical motion into circular motion, moving your car ahead.
The valvetrain is crucial in regulating the timing of fuel and air mixture and controlling exhaust gas release. This utilizes a intricate network of camshafts, valves, and springs, keeping your engine running smoothly.
Typical engine issues can present themselves in multiple ways. Problems with starting often point to fuel system or electrical issues—examine the battery, starter motor, and fuel pump.
Engine performance concerns like misfires or rough running could be due to clogged fuel injectors, damaged oxygen sensors, or worn spark plugs.
Engine overheating commonly occurs, usually resulting from coolant leaks, malfunctioning thermostats, or failing water pumps. Watch out for symptoms like unusual noises or physical signs such as excessive exhaust smoke.
Regular maintenance, including timely oil changes and air filter replacements, is essential for preventing these issues.
Transmission and Drivetrain Basics
Understanding the intricacies of your vehicle's transmission and drivetrain is key to ensuring seamless power delivery and overall performance. The powertrain, comprising both engine and drivetrain, converts the engine's raw power into managed movement.
Fundamental to this system, the transmission regulates power delivery, fine-tuning two primary types: stick shift, requiring clutch and gear input, and automatic, which automatically controls gear changes via hydraulic systems.
When considering automatic transmissions, the torque converter serves a critical role by linking the engine to the transmission. It boosts torque output through fluid coupling, ensuring energy is transferred optimally.
The driveshaft, made from strong materials like steel or aluminum, transmits rotational force from the transmission to the differential, featuring constant-velocity joints for smooth operation.
Understanding the differential is essential; it enables wheels to rotate at different speeds during turns, preserving power delivery, especially in vehicles with multiple driven wheels.
Axles link the wheels to the differential, varying in configuration based on design requirements.
To maintain optimal performance, periodic upkeep and checking of these components are crucial, improving fuel efficiency and stopping costly repairs.
Understanding Brake Maintenance
Maneuvering through the complex world of brake system maintenance guarantees both reliable operation on the road. Your vehicle's brake system is an intricate collection of components including brake pads, rotors, calipers, brake lines, and fluid. Each component demands careful monitoring for optimal performance.
Regular inspections, optimally performed once a year or more often depending on your driving conditions, are crucial for catching problems before they escalate.
Brake fluid maintenance is essential as it attracts moisture, causing reduced efficiency and corrosion. Replace it every 2-3 years or 30K miles. Similarly, observe brake pads—they deteriorate naturally and typically need replacement between 25K and 70K miles.
Watch for warning signs like strange noises—like squealing, grinding, or metal-on-metal sounds—and symptoms like a soft brake pedal, car drifting to one side, pedal vibrations, or longer stopping distances. These signals require urgent inspection from a professional technician.
Periodic checks involves monthly brake fluid monitoring and pad thickness evaluations. Also, practice smooth braking techniques and refrain from riding the brakes.
Essential Suspension and Steering Elements
Mastering the sophisticated systems of suspension and steering is crucial for guaranteeing your vehicle's performance and safety. Your suspension system depends on various springs—such as coil, leaf, torsion bars, and air—to bear the vehicle's weight and absorb impacts.
Damping components including struts, shock absorbers, bushings, and control arms control wheel travel and minimize vibration. Combined, these elements balance your ride, enhancing driving dynamics.
In steering, key components consist of the steering wheel, column, rack and pinion, tie rods, and ball joints. Power steering systems—whether hybrid, hydraulic, or electric—provide essential assistance, making steering more precise and easier.
Recognizing signs of issues is critical. If you observe excessive bouncing, uneven tire wear, or difficulty steering, these could indicate suspension or steering issues.
Periodic inspections are crucial. Examine power steering fluid levels, bushings, and shock absorbers regularly. Resolve any vehicle pulling or unusual noises promptly.
Periodic alignment checks and maintenance of moving parts can avoid long-term damage. By understanding and servicing these systems, you ensure a smoother driving experience, consistent road contact, and predictable braking, finally boosting your vehicle's overall safety and performance.
Vehicle Electrical Diagnostics
Delving into the fundamental aspects of your vehicle's electrical system plays a vital role in maintaining maximum efficiency and dependability. Contemporary cars depend on these systems for functions ranging from vital operations to comfort features, making diagnostics an essential competency.
Equip yourself with the proper tools: a voltage meter for measuring electrical parameters; electronic diagnostic devices for interpreting system alerts; and oscilloscopes for analyzing electrical waveforms.
Initiate diagnostics by collecting data on symptoms and checking components for physical defects. A methodical process begins with a power source assessment, followed by charging system verification and earth point validation.
Electrical connection testing are important to identify any electrical circuit breaks. Common issues often involve the starting system, such as battery deficiencies or starter mechanism issues, and charging system faults like alternator and voltage regulation problems.
Advanced techniques, like electrical pattern reading and current drain analysis, help unravel complex issues. For computer system diagnostics, confirm ECU communication and sensor integrity are intact.
Regular upkeep, including battery terminal cleaning and wiring system checks, remains vital. Seek professional help for complex or safety-related problems, documenting repairs to identify repeated failures and confirm thorough resolutions.

The Essentials About ASE Certification
Selecting an experienced auto repair shop may seem daunting, but understanding ASE certification simplifies your decision. ASE certification, granted by the National Institute for Automotive Service Excellence, serves as the automotive industry's standard for technical proficiency.
While looking for a repair facility, watch for the distinctive blue seal and technicians displaying ASE patches. These indicators demonstrate that the technicians have met rigorous standards through extensive testing in specialized areas including engine repair, brakes, and electrical systems.
Technicians earn ASE certification by finishing 24 months of hands-on experience or matching one year of experience with a two-year automotive degree, then passing specific exams. To retain certification, they must requalify every five years, guaranteeing they remain current on the latest automotive technology.
This devotion to continuous education assures that certified technicians can competently identify and resolve modern vehicles' sophisticated systems.
Master ASE Certification reaches higher levels, demanding technicians to pass multiple tests across diverse specialties, showing their thorough expertise.

Preventive Service Strategies
Your vehicle's longevity can be significantly extended through a well-planned preventive maintenance strategy.
Implement scheduled service intervals between 5,000 and 8,000 miles or about every six months. Basic maintenance covers changing oils and filters, checking fluid levels, tire rotation, and basic inspections.
At 15,000-mile intervals, perform intermediate services with complete car examinations and replace transmission fluid and air filters. Every 30,000 miles, perform major services like changing brake fluid and spark plugs, along with replacing differential oil and cabin filters.
Proper fluid care is crucial. Consistently replace engine oil every 5,000 to 8,000 miles.
Transmission fluid needs replacement at 30,000-mile intervals to maintain performance. Refresh brake fluid every two years or 25,000 miles, and replace coolant every 30,000 miles or two years to avoid overheating.
Maintain proper filter care: Change engine air filters every 15,000 miles and change cabin air filters every 30,000 miles.
Change oil filters with every engine oil replacement.
For tire care, perform tire rotation between 5,000 and 8,000 miles, verify alignment yearly, and inspect tire pressure monthly.
Regularly inspect battery connections for oxidation, monitor performance, and maintain clean terminals to ensure dependable performance.

Understanding Your Consumer Rights
Navigating the world of auto repairs can be complex, but being aware of your consumer rights ensures you're protected. Auto repair laws compel shops to furnish written estimates for repairs above $100, demanding your approval before supplementary work. They cannot legally exceed the estimated costs by more than 10% without your written consent.
Be sure to check for your rights displayed prominently at the shop, including your ability to examine replaced parts and review your vehicle before payment.
Service guarantees are essential. Repair shops are required to extend a minimum three-month or 3,000-mile warranty on repairs and parts unless specifically excluded. Ensure the warranty terms are documented, outlining warranty scope, timeframes, and claim procedures.
If disputes arise, begin with direct communication—send a complaint and demand a response within 14 days. If unresolved, explore alternative dispute resolutions like the Better Business Bureau's AUTO LINE or state regulators. Legal action should be your final option.
Feel free to seek a second opinion. Compare shop quotes, warranties, and certifications. Research the shop's history with issues to validate quality assurance.

How Do I Maximize My Car Battery's Life?
To maximize your vehicle's battery life, regularly examine and clean terminals, make sure it's firmly mounted, avoid frequent short trips, and test its charge. Preserve ideal charge levels and consider using a battery tender when not in use.
What Are the Indicators When My Transmission is Failing?
You're noticing a failing transmission when you experience rough or delayed gear shifts, abnormal noises, transmission fluid leaks, or a burning smell. Pay attention to warning lights and erratic RPMs for further confirmation of transmission issues.
What's the Best Way to Select the Right Oil for My Car?
Check your car's manual for oil requirements. Factor in your driving conditions and climate. Choose oil with the appropriate viscosity and API rating. Ask a professional if unsure. Regularly check oil levels and replace it as recommended.
What's the Right Time to Replace My Car's Timing Belt?
Review your car's manual for exact timing belt replacement intervals, usually every sixty to one hundred thousand miles. Watch for signs like squealing noises or starting problems. Never postpone replacement to prevent engine damage or major repairs.
How Do I Go About for Troubleshooting a Car's Electrical Concern?
Begin by testing the battery and fuses for faults. Use a multimeter to check voltage and continuity. Examine wiring for damage. Reference the vehicle's manual for relevant electrical components and analyze each circuit systematically for issues.
